Technical Basis Report for Large Fire Accidents Involving Aboveground Tanks/Vessels
This document analyzes large fire accidents involving aboveground tanks and vessels during Demonstration Bulk Vitrification System (DBVS) operations. The fire accident scenarios are consistent with RPP-22461,'Preliminary Fire Hazard Analysis (PFHA) for DBVS'. The radiological and toxicological consequences are determined for a wide spectrum of fire sizes to bracket the range of possible consequences resulting from large fires involving aboveground tanks/vessels that are part of DBVS.
